When running an execution, Nomad continuously reads from the stdin
reader. Because the readers we implemented (codeOceanToRawReader and
nullReader) return zero if there is no input available, this leads to
busy waiting and a high CPU load on Poseidon. By waiting indefinitely in
case of the nullReader and for at least one byte on case of the
codeOceanToRawReader before returning, we prevent this issue.
